2
2019 · Physics · Modern Physics · Atoms And Nuclei
JEE MAIN 2019 ONLINE 10TH APRIL EVENING SLOT
Two radioactive substances A and B have decay constants 5\(\lambda\) and \(\lambda\) respectively. At t = 0, a sample has the same number of the two nuclei. The time taken for the ratio of the number of nuclei to become \({\left( {{1 \over e}} \right)^2}\) will be :
A
\({2 \over \lambda }\)
B
\({1 \over {4\lambda }}\)
C
\({1 \over {2\lambda }}\)
D
\({1 \over {\lambda }}\)

5
2019 · Physics · Mechanics · Waves
JEE MAIN 2019 ONLINE 10TH APRIL EVENING SLOT
A source of sound S is moving with a velocity of 50 m/s towards a stationary observer. The observer measures the frequency of the source as 1000 Hz. What will be the apparent frequency of the source when it is moving away from the observer after crossing him? (Take velocity of sound in air is 350 m/s)
A
750 Hz
B
857 Hz
C
807 Hz
D
1143 Hz
